Issue Information Issue ID #000065 Issue Type Issue Severity 0 – None Assigned Status 23 – Fix Accepted By Reporter Version 2014.021 Fixed in 2014.020 Memory Allocation Fault in SE WESTPAC Backyard ScenarioPosted by eeustice on 09 November 2013 - 07:08 PM In the SE TG ALC located near northern Japan has 25 CV's and 2196 planes. When I go to Ready Aircraft I get a Memory Allocation Fault. If I Reduce the number of planed down to 1866 I can edit the aircraft load outs in the SE. If I add 5 planes and increase the number of AC to 1871 the Memory Allocation Fault returns. The SE I am using is version 2009.100. Attached are the original SE file and the a SE file with 1866 planes and 1871 planes along with my edited db. If you have any questions please let me know.
